      <description>&lt;P&gt;I accepted an upgrade offer of 70k MR from Gold -&amp;gt; Platinum, about halfway through my second year of having the Gold card. My annual fee is going to post in a few weeks, after 7 months of owning the Platinum.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;If I cancel right after the annual fee posts, is that considered ok (like the usual 13 month clock)? Or would that be considered an early cancellation (like a 7 month cancellation) that would have clawbacks / blacklisting?&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Any Amex experts know how this should be handled?&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;(Other detail, I just got approved for the Schwab Platinum since I figured I'd get that bonus in before potentially getting on Amex's bad side.)&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;If you get on Amex's bad side, they can claw back your Schwab bonus too, or even close all your accounts. I would never cancel or downgrade any Amex card for at least 13 statements since the last product change. Your best bet is to ask for a retention offer when the AF posts, and then cancel or downgrade 13 months after that. If you don't get a retention offer, just suck it up and pay the AF — imo not worth risking your relationship with Amex over $695.&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;I just downgraded from Gold to Green but had to wait at least 12 months since my last retention offer or risk clawback; which the agent via chat explained. My annual fee usually hits in Dec but I accepted a retention offer on 1/7/22. I had to wait till after 1/8/23 to downgrade with no adverse actions.&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;BLOCKQUOTE&gt;&lt;HR /&gt;&lt;a href="https://ficoforums.myfico.com/t5/user/viewprofilepage/user-id/972497"&gt;@BronzeTrader&lt;/a&gt;&amp;nbsp;wrote:&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;P&gt;When you accepted the upgrade offer, you also accepted the AmEx new T&amp;amp;C.&amp;nbsp; It normally says you have to keep it open for 12 months.&amp;nbsp; There are also some other terms.&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Those are the terms that you need to follow.&amp;nbsp; Sure some play game and get away from that.&amp;nbsp; Some can't.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;HR /&gt;&lt;/BLOCKQUOTE&gt;&lt;P&gt;Correct. &amp;nbsp;A few years ago, verbiage that Welcome Offers, upgrade offers, and retention bonuses would be forfeited if a card were closed or downgraded within one year was added to the terms. &amp;nbsp;Thankfully the one time I could have fallen into this trap, the chat agent let me know. &amp;nbsp;I was trying to close a Delta Platinum card after the AF posted and had received a retention offer 364 days earlier. &amp;nbsp;They thankfully advised me to contact them again in 2 days! &amp;nbsp;(That is the only Amex card I have ever actually closed or downgraded.)&lt;/P&gt;</description>
